Liberal Democratic Party proposed to ban the work of collectors

State Duma deputies from the LDPR party have prepared a bill to ban the work of collection agencies in Russia, reported RT with a link to the document. The initiative has not yet been submitted to parliament, it is not in the database of the State Duma.
According to RT, deputies propose to amend Art. 5 of the Law “On consumer credit (loan)”. The document also proposes to invalidate the federal law “On the protection of the rights and legitimate interests of individuals in the implementation of activities to return overdue debts and on amendments to the Federal law “On microfinance activities and microfinance organizations””.
According to the authors of the project, the ban on the work of collectors will free a large number of people who can do productive work. “We consider it necessary in the current conditions to prohibit the activities of organizations on the territory of the Russian Federation whose main activity is the return of overdue debts, as well as to prohibit the involvement of other persons by the creditor to interact with the debtor aimed at returning overdue debts,” the explanatory note says. .
Earlier, the deputy head of the LDPR faction, Yaroslav Nilov, told Kommersant that in the spring session, the priorities of the Liberal Democratic Party will be the indexation of pensions for working pensioners, a ban on collectors, an increase in the minimum wage and other initiatives.
